    <title>2020 (6) TMI 519 - AUTHORITY FOR ADVANCE RULINGS, HIMACHAL PRADESH</title>
    <link>https://www.taxtmi.com/caselaws?id=396144</link>
    <description>The Authority ruled that the applicant, a public service broadcaster, was not eligible for input tax credit on services provided by contractors for transporting employees as they failed to demonstrate a legal obligation for such services. The applicable GST rate on renting cabs was determined based on specific conditions outlined in the relevant legal provisions, allowing for ITC at 12% only if certain conditions were met.</description>
